About the role

Reporting to the VP of Manufacturing, you will set the strategic direction for global sourcing and procurement, leading a high-performing supply chain organization across multiple regions. This role serves as a key executive partner in driving innovation, cost leadership, and operational resilience, ensuring Tritium maintains a sustainable competitive advantage in the procurement of capital, materials, and services worldwide. This role is based in Middle Tennessee.

What You’ll Do

• Procurement & Sourcing: Define and own the enterprise-wide procurement and category sourcing vision, setting multi-year strategies for supplier selection, contract negotiations, and total cost of ownership while ensuring supply continuity and long-term competitive positioning.

• New Product Introduction & Technology Roadmap: Champion supply chain integration at the executive level across all product development initiatives, shaping technology roadmaps, directing contract manufacturer relationships, and establishing Tritium as a leader in emerging supply technologies.

• Supplier & Risk Management: Direct enterprise-wide supplier governance, strategic rationalization, and performance frameworks while setting organizational risk tolerance and leading mitigation strategies across all supply chain risk categories (commodities, lead times, obsolescence, logistics, geopolitical, cyber).

• Compliance & Trade: Establish and enforce global trade compliance policies, proactively navigating tariff regimes, customs frameworks, and evolving international trade regulations to protect margin and ensure uninterrupted operations.

• Operational Efficiency: Set the strategic direction for end-to-end supply chain infrastructure, overseeing systems architecture, freight strategy, warehouse network design, and material flow to achieve best-in-class delivery performance and cost structure.

• Performance & Data Insights: Own the supply chain analytics and reporting function, establishing KPIs and executive dashboards that enable data-driven decision-making at the board and C-suite level, and driving a culture of continuous performance improvement.

• Process Improvement & Collaboration: Champion enterprise-wide transformation initiatives, partnering with leadership to align supply chain strategy with business objectives and drive measurable improvements in cost, speed, and quality.

• Leadership & Talent Development: Architect and evolve a world-class global supply chain organization, defining structure, capabilities, and succession plans while attracting, developing, and retaining top-tier talent.
